Abstract

The utility model relates to a fast energy-saving boiler. The utility model is characterized in that the utility model adopts boiler pipes whose the diameter of pipe openings are bigger, the boiler pipes are directly welded on a boiler cylinder, the boiler pipes which are alternatively arranged in the boiler cylinder which is connected with the boiler pipes into one body are level with the outer margin of the boiler, cylinder, the boiler pipes are communicated with an outer cylinder, an upper drum, a lower drum and a jacket between an inner cylinder and an outer cylinder of residual heat, the outer cylinder of residual heat is also provided with a spraying water washing device and a dust removing drain pipe, and a drain pipe which is used for cleaning boiler scale is arranged under the outer cylinder. The utility model can burn boiled water 500 kg and hot water 200 kg with 8 kg coal consumption. The utility model has the advantages of fast energy saving, simple structure and easy manufacture. The utility model can be used as life boilers in institutions, schools and countryside and steam boilers in factories. The utility model can be applied to common machine factories or boiler factories.

Description

A kind of fast energy-saving boiler
The utility model relates to a kind of improvement of boiler for domestic, and particularly a kind of fast energy-saving boiler is suitable for office, school, boiler for domestic is made in the rural area and factory makes steam boiler.
The arrangement of existing vertical boiler for domestic boiler tube all is direct barrel type or the coiled that a direction is arranged, and the less high-temperature flue gas that makes of caliber directly passes through from straight tube or coil pipe gap, make water-filled boiler tube not have the process of abundant heat absorption and cause a large amount of heat energy dissipations, cause energy waste, prolong and heat up water the time, boiler cleans also inconvenient.
The purpose of this utility model is intended to overcome above-mentioned the deficiencies in the prior art part, has designed a kind of fast energy-saving boiler that can effectively overcome above-mentioned shortcoming.
The purpose of this utility model is such realization: upper drum and lower drum and the weldering of outer jacket casing are one, the waste heat apparatus of being made up of waste heat urceolus and waste heat inner core is housed on the urceolus tube edge, in upper and lower drum and waste heat inner core, all disposes staggered, boiler tube, boiler tube and communicate with chuck between urceolus and upper and lower drum and waste heat inner/outer tube with the concordant big caliber of the outer rim of cylindrical shell.
The bell shape hydroblasting device of doing dedusting is housed on the waste heat urceolus.
Urceolus is equipped with blow-off pipe down and on the hydroblasting device.
After adding coal combustion in the combustion chamber, the flue gas of temperature flowing contacts with chuck with water-filled boiler tube, and constantly mobile high temperature gas flow is tortuous to be contacted with pipe, cover, makes it fully absorb heat, thereby realizes quick, purpose of energy saving.Through testing: dress water 200kg in dress water 500kg, the waste heat tube in upper and lower drum water pipe, draw burning, normal combustion with coal (coal calorific value by 5000-5500 kilocalorie/time) 8kg from the coal of lighting a fire, after half an hour, the water of 500kg is promptly to boiling point, and the water temperature of 200kg reaches (inflow temperature is 18 ℃) about 80 ℃.The utility model also has simple in structure, easy to manufacture, advantages such as boiler cleaning, good dedusting effect.

Referring to Fig. 1-Fig. 6, adopt segmentation to make welded seal and connect into holistic tower boiler.All directly welding the staggered many piece boiler tubes 19 concordant (the boiler tube diameter is bigger than existing shape caliber, as adopting the 100-150mm caliber) on upper drum 4, lower drum 2 and the waste heat inner core 9 with the outer rim of cylindrical shell (4,2,9).Upper drum 4 and lower drum 2 are welded into one with urceolus 3 covers and form a chuck 18, and each boiler tube 19 communicates with chuck 18.(bolt that adds sealing ring connects) is installed on 3 edge of urceolus goes up the waste heat apparatus of forming by waste heat inner core 9 and waste heat urceolus 10.On waste heat urceolus 10, be welded with bell shape hydroblasting device 14 (this device is used as getting rid of flue dust), it is provided with barrel-type casing outward, housing has dedusting blow-off pipe 11, the hemispherical water body of ejection can make the flue dust cleaning of chimney 12 bottoms from then on manage 11 discharges.The flue gas that last chimney 12 is discharged is white in color, to reach dust emission standard.Also be provided with the blow-off pipe 1 that cleans incrustation scale into boiler in the urceolus bottom.Because of boiler tube 19 calibers that adopted are thicker, so the incrustation scale in it also is easy to clean.In addition the utility model boiler also is provided with automatical pouring appliance 16 and heat water valve 6, heat control valve 5, fire door 17 etc., and safety attachments such as Pressure gauge 7, safety valve 8, water level meter 15, thermometer 13, necessary external pipe.Also be provided with the wind turning plate door of automatic unlatching in the chimney 12.Prior art is adopted in the combustion chamber.When being full of water in boiler tube 19 and the chuck 18 behind the last full running water, coal igniting manufacture hot water, boiling water and steam then.
The utility model product design size, external diameter: 600-1500mm, height: 2800-4200mm can optionally make boiling water or the steam boiler of 0.1-1T.

Claims (3)

1. fast energy-saving boiler, comprise compositions such as shell, drum, fire door, water pipe, injector, chimney and safety attachment, it is characterized in that: upper drum and lower drum and the weldering of outer jacket casing are one, the waste heat apparatus of being made up of waste heat urceolus and waste heat inner core is housed on the urceolus tube edge, in upper and lower drum and waste heat inner core, all dispose staggered, communicate with chuck between urceolus and last lower drum and waste heat inner/outer tube with the concordant big caliber boiler tube of the outer rim of cylindrical shell, boiler tube.
2. fast energy-saving boiler according to claim 1 is characterized in that: bell shape hydroblasting device is housed on the waste heat urceolus.
3. according to claim 1,2 described fast energy-saving boilers, it is characterized in that: urceolus is equipped with blow-off pipe down and on the hydroblasting device.
